What is Leak Detection?
Leak detection is the process of identifying, locating, and isolating sources of water or gas leaks in infrastructure, such as pipes, ducts, and vessels. It's a critical step in ensuring public safety, preventing damage to property, and reducing waste.
Why is Leak Detection Important?
Leak detection has numerous benefits, including:
- Safety: Identifying leaks early can prevent accidents, injuries, and fatalities.
- Cost Savings: Regular maintenance and repair of leaky infrastructure can reduce unexpected repairs and costs.
- Increased Efficiency: Leak detection helps optimize resource allocation, reducing downtime and improving overall performance.
